Default Easiest way to add MP3 capability?

I want to be able to play mp3's and since the cd player can't handle this format what is the easiest/cheapest way to add this capability to my stock radio on my 2002 coupe? thanks...

Originally Posted by gkohl
I have an IPOD2CAR adapter for my IPOD. Works great. Just disconnect the CD player and plug in this adapter. They also make a version for generic MP3 players. The link that C5 BearsFan posted is for the MP3 version. It is made by Peripheral. Just search on Google for ipod2car and you'll find it.
I bought this unit several years ago and it is fantastic!!! (That's 3 exclamation points.) Cost me just under $100 and took all of 15 minutes to install. It runs of the CD controls (full functions) of the vette's stock stereo system. Hooks up to the cd changer in the trunk (that's how mine is hooked up) or to the back of the stereo head unit (that is a more time intensive installation, but worth it.)
